Trauma Informed Practice in Early Childhood and OSHC

About the event

We welcome children and their families from diverse backgrounds and experiences in all of our education and care settings, so it is valuable to approach our work with increased knowledge and skill when it comes to understanding how children who have experienced trauma can be better supported and ultimately experience improved outcomes. This 2 hour session provides educators with an introduction that will assist in building an understanding of developmental trauma and its impact on the developing brain. Educators will explore the essential principles of implementing a trauma-informed program and begin building their knowledge of trauma-aware practices.

Educators can expect to:

ü Build your understanding of developmental trauma

ü Gain insight into the impacts of trauma on the brain, development and behaviour

ü Begin to explore essential principles for establishing a trauma-informed program in early childhood

ü education.

ü Access resources and ideas for support.
